PoE Lighting vs Smart Lighting

 PoE lighting is a new type of smart lighting system that offers a number of advantages over traditional systems. PoE (Power over Ethernet) is a technology that allows power to be sent over Ethernet cables.

This means that PoElighting fixtures can be powered by the same Ethernet cables that are used to connect them to the network. This simplifies installation and reduces costs.

In addition, PoE lighting is more energy-efficient than traditional lighting systems, and it offers a higher level of control and flexibility. For example, PoE lighting can be dimmed or turned off completely without affecting other lights on the same circuit.

How The PoE System Works

Power over Ethernet (PoE) is a technology that enables Ethernet network cables to deliver both power and data to devices. This is beneficial for several reasons.

First, it simplifies installation by eliminating the need to install separate power outlets for devices.

Second, it reduces cabling costs by eliminating the need for additional power cables.

Third, it increases flexibility by allowing devices to be located in areas where power outlets are not readily available.

PoE systems work by using special Ethernet cables that contain conductors for both power and data. The PoE injector then sends power over the Ethernet cable to the device.

The device then uses this power to operate as usual. PoE is a convenient and cost-effective way to power devices. It is also becoming increasingly popular as more and more devices are designed to use this technology.

Types Of Smart Lighting

When it comes to smart lighting systems, there are two main types: Power over Ethernet (PoE) and traditional. Both have their own benefits and drawbacks, and the right choice for your business will depend on various factors.

PoE systems tend to be more expensive upfront, but they can offer significant long-term savings. Because they utilize existing Ethernet infrastructure, they eliminate the need for extra wiring and equipment.

In addition, PoE systems are more scalable and easier to install, making them ideal for businesses that are looking to expand their smart lighting network in the future.

On the other hand, traditional systems are less expensive to purchase and can be used with a wider range of fixtures.

However, they often require additional hardware and can be more difficult to install. Ultimately, the best option for your business will depend on your specific needs and budget.

Which type of business would be best suited for a PoE lighting system

While PoE lighting systems have a number of advantages, they are not well-suited for all businesses. One of the key considerations is the size of the business.

A PoE lighting system requires a network of Ethernet cables to be installed, which can be costly and time-consuming for large businesses. In addition, PoE lighting systems are not compatible with all types of light fixtures.

LED bulbs are typically required, which can also add to the cost. As a result, businesses that are on a tight budget or have limited space may want to consider other options. However, for small businesses that are looking for an energy-efficient and easy-to-install lighting system, PoE could be the ideal solution.

End Words

PoE lighting is a rapidly growing segment of the lighting industry due to the many benefits it offers compared to traditional lighting technologies. PoE (Power over Ethernet) is a technology that allows electrical power to be transmitted along with data over a standard Ethernet cable.

This provides a number of advantages over traditional wired and wireless lighting technologies. First, PoE lighting is much easier to install since only a single type of cable needs to be run to each light fixture. Second, PoE lighting is much more energy efficient since it eliminates the need for additional power supplies and transformers.

Finally, PoE lighting can be easily controlled and monitored using existing network infrastructure, making it an ideal solution for large-scale deployments. As a result, PoE lighting is becoming increasingly popular for both new construction and retrofit projects.
